Sinton setting his sights on strike ace Sills
Saturday 11th June 2011, 11:29AM BST.
AFC Telford United are tracking experienced striker Tim Sills – with manager Andy Sinton set to hold talks with the 6ft 2ins marksman next week.
Sills is a free agent after being released by Aldershot last month and would fit Sinton’s brief of finding an accomplished Conference goalscorer.
The 31-year-old has a career strike-rate of around one goal every three games and was prolific in the Conference Premier during his first spell with Aldershot, as well as helping fire Torquay to promotion in 2009-10.
Assistant manager Darren Read made contact with the player yesterday and talks are likely to carry on once Sinton returns from a short trip to the Bahamas, where he is playing in a legends football tournament.
